Title: Mastering Conversational AI Development: Top 3 Tips for Success

Meta Description: Discover expert tips for developing effective conversational AI, from optimizing NLP models to integrating backends efficiently. Learn how to engage users and streamline data connectivity for improved performance.

Introduction:

In the realm of artificial intelligence, conversational AI has emerged as a powerful tool for enhancing user experiences. By leveraging natural language processing (NLP) models and seamless conversation flows, developers can create chatbots and virtual assistants that engage users in meaningful interactions. In this article, we will explore three key tips for mastering conversational AI development, from maximizing data for model training to integrating backend systems for optimal performance.

Optimizing NLP Models for Data:

To kickstart your conversational AI development journey, it is essential to optimize your NLP models for data. This involves maximizing the quality and quantity of data available for training your models. By tweaking hyperparameters and diversifying your dataset through data augmentation techniques, you can enhance the accuracy and robustness of your AI algorithms. Additionally, incorporating sentiment analysis and entity recognition can help your models better understand user inputs and provide more personalized responses.

Designing Smooth Conversation Flows:

Creating smooth conversation flows is crucial for ensuring a seamless user experience with your conversational AI. Simplify user navigation by designing intuitive interfaces and clear prompts. Shift topics seamlessly by implementing context switching capabilities that allow the AI to maintain continuity in conversations. Personalize interactions with branching logic that adapts responses based on user inputs and preferences. By prioritizing user engagement and context relevance, you can create chatbots that feel natural and intuitive to interact with.

Integrating Backends Efficiently:

Efficient backend integration is key to unlocking the full potential of your conversational AI. By seamlessly connecting your AI frontend to backend systems, you can facilitate smooth data exchange, prompt responses, and improved performance. Streamline data connectivity by implementing APIs and webhooks that enable real-time data retrieval and updates. Manage data effectively to minimize latency and ensure that your AI stays responsive and accurate in its interactions.

Conclusion:

Mastering conversational AI development requires a combination of technical expertise, creative design, and a deep understanding of user engagement principles. By optimizing NLP models for data, designing smooth conversation flows, and integrating backends efficiently, developers can create AI-powered chatbots and virtual assistants that deliver exceptional user experiences. Embrace these tips and best practices to elevate your conversational AI projects to new heights of success.

External Link: Learn more about conversational AI development techniques here.

Positive Sentiment Word: Mastering

Power Keyword: Success

Key Takeaways

Developing effective conversational AI involves optimizing NLP models with extensive data, designing intuitive conversation flows, and efficiently integrating backend systems. By fine-tuning NLP models with a wealth of data, developers can enhance the AI's understanding and response capabilities. Crafting intuitive conversation flows ensures a seamless interaction between users and the AI, leading to a more engaging experience. Furthermore, integrating backend systems efficiently enables the AI to access and retrieve information swiftly, enhancing its overall functionality. To achieve success in conversational AI development, it is essential to strike a balance between data augmentation for model diversity and combining technical expertise with creative design.

In summary, effective conversational AI development requires a holistic approach that encompasses data optimization, intuitive design, and seamless integration. By leveraging extensive data for NLP models, creating intuitive conversation flows, and integrating backend systems efficiently, developers can craft AI solutions that deliver exceptional user experiences and reliable performance.

Key Takeaways:

  • Optimize NLP models with extensive data
  • Design intuitive conversation flows
  • Efficiently integrate backend systems

NLP Model Optimization

Enhancing NLP Model Performance through Data Optimization

  • Leveraging Extensive Data for NLP Model Training
  • The Significance of Hyperparameter Tuning in NLP Models
  • Maximizing Model Efficiency with Hyperparameter Adjustment
  • Boosting Model Diversity with Data Augmentation Techniques
  • Balancing Data Augmentation for Enhanced Model Performance

Seamless Conversation Flow Design

Crafting Engaging Conversation Flows for Seamless User Experience

  • Simplify Navigation: Creating Intuitive Paths
  • Sustain Interest: Seamless Topic Transitions
  • Tailored Conversations: Personalization with Branching Logic
  • Contextual Relevance: Natural Language Understanding
  • User Scenario Testing: Optimizing Engagement Levels

Efficient Backend Integration

Enhancing Data Exchange through Backend Integration

Efficient Data Connectivity for Seamless Communication

Real-time Data Retrieval for Prompt Responses

Streamlining Data Management for Improved Performance

Minimizing Latency Issues for Smooth Interactions

Optimizing System Performance with Proper Integration

Prioritizing Seamless Data Flow for Enhanced User Experience

Frequently Asked Questions

How Do You Develop Conversational Ai?

How do you effectively develop conversational AI?

Understanding natural language and utilizing machine learning are essential for developing conversational AI effectively. It is important to create intuitive conversation flows, integrate with back-end services, conduct thorough performance testing, and iterate based on user feedback. Prioritizing accuracy, ensuring seamless interactions, and continuously improving the AI system are key factors in the development process.

What Are Two Main Components of a Conversational Artificial Intelligence Solution?

In conversational AI solutions, the main components are Natural Language Understanding (NLU) models and Dialog Management Systems. NLU helps interpret user intent and extract relevant data, while Dialog Management controls conversation flow to ensure smooth interactions and accurate responses. These two components work together to enable effective communication between users and AI systems.

How does Natural Language Understanding (NLU) contribute to conversational AI solutions?

NLU plays a crucial role in understanding user input by deciphering intent and extracting relevant information. It helps the AI system comprehend natural language queries and commands, enabling it to provide accurate responses.

What is the function of Dialog Management in conversational AI solutions?

Dialog Management is responsible for controlling the flow of conversations between users and AI systems. It ensures that interactions are seamless, contextually relevant, and follow a logical progression, leading to a more engaging user experience.

How do NLU models improve the accuracy of conversational AI interactions?

NLU models enhance the accuracy of conversational AI interactions by accurately interpreting user intent and extracting key information from their inputs. This enables the AI system to provide relevant and personalized responses, leading to more effective communication.

What role does Dialog Management play in maintaining the flow of conversations in AI solutions?

Dialog Management systems oversee the flow of conversations by managing turn-taking, context switching, and maintaining coherence in the dialogue. This ensures that interactions between users and AI systems are natural, engaging, and productive.

How do NLU and Dialog Management systems collaborate to enhance conversational AI solutions?

NLU and Dialog Management systems work together to create a seamless user experience. NLU helps the AI system understand user input, while Dialog Management controls the conversation flow, ensuring that the responses are contextually relevant and coherent.

What are the benefits of using NLU models and Dialog Management systems in conversational AI solutions?

What Is Level 3 of Conversational Ai?

What are Level 3 capabilities in conversational AI?

Level 3 capabilities in conversational AI represent advanced algorithms that enable contextual understanding and personalized responses. This level empowers AI to engage in sophisticated dialogues, interpret user intent, and maintain context for more human-like interactions.

How do advanced algorithms enhance conversational AI at Level 3?

Advanced algorithms at Level 3 improve conversational AI by enabling it to understand context, provide tailored responses, and engage in more complex interactions with users. This results in a more natural and human-like conversation experience.

What is the significance of user intent in Level 3 conversational AI?

User intent is crucial in Level 3 conversational AI as it allows the system to decipher what the user is trying to achieve or communicate. By understanding user intent, AI can provide more relevant and accurate responses, leading to a more effective and engaging conversation.

How does Level 3 conversational AI sustain context during interactions?

At Level 3, conversational AI sustains context by remembering previous interactions, understanding the flow of conversation, and incorporating this information into future responses. This capability ensures that the conversation remains coherent and relevant throughout.

What sets Level 3 conversational AI apart from lower levels of AI?

Level 3 conversational AI stands out from lower levels by its ability to engage in more complex and meaningful dialogues, interpret context accurately, and provide personalized responses based on user intent. This leads to a more natural and human-like conversational experience.

How does Level 3 conversational AI contribute to more human-like interactions?

Level 3 conversational AI contributes to more human-like interactions by understanding context, interpreting user intent, and providing tailored responses. This level of AI can engage in conversations that feel more natural, dynamic, and personalized, enhancing the overall user experience.

What Are the Main Challenges in Conversational Ai?

How can conversational AI improve engagement and personalization?

To enhance engagement and personalization, conversational AI must focus on addressing challenges such as context retention, natural language understanding, and adapting to user preferences. By overcoming these obstacles, conversational AI development can be optimized to deliver better user experiences.

Conclusion

You've learned the key tips for developing effective conversational AI:

optimizing NLP models,

designing seamless conversation flows,

and integrating backends efficiently.

Did you know that by 2023, the global market for conversational AI is projected to reach $11.3 billion?

By implementing these strategies, you can create AI solutions that truly engage and delight users, positioning your projects for success in this rapidly growing industry.

Stay ahead of the curve and craft AI experiences that make a lasting impact.